Quick Tips

  • Sessions are stateful - Each conversation maintains history and can be resumed
  • Agents are specialists - Delegate complex tasks to purpose-built agents
  • Bundles compose - Layer multiple bundles to build custom capabilities
  • Modules extend - Add new functionality without modifying the kernel
  • Context is king - What the model sees determines what it can do

Key Principles

Modular Design

Everything in Amplifier is designed to be composed, replaced, and extended. No monoliths.

Thin Bundles

Bundles should be minimal—just enough to define behavior, composed from reusable parts.

Ruthless Simplicity

Complexity is the enemy. Every abstraction must justify its existence.

Trust in Emergence

Complex behaviors emerge from simple, well-defined components working together.
